WebJul 21, 2024 · If your sweet peas have stunted growth, yellowing leaves, or aren’t blooming, the first thing to check is that they are getting at least six hours of sun per day. Beyond that, the most common reasons for sweet peas growing poorly is too much water or an imbalance of soil nutrition.
